Question 51. Which of the following is untrue about distance based methods?
  1.    The computed evolutionary distances can be used to construct a matrix of distances between all individual pairs of taxa
  2.    Clustering is the only method among the algorithms for the distance-based tree-building method
  3.    The clustering-type algorithms compute a tree based on a distance matrix starting from the most similar sequence pairs
  4.    Based on the pairwise distance scores in the matrix, a phylogenetic tree can be constructed for all the taxa involved
 Discuss Question
Answer: Option B. -> Clustering is the only method among the algorithms for the distance-based tree-building method

Question 53. Which of the following is untrue about the Unweighted Pair Group Method Using Arithmetic Average?
  1.    The simplest clustering method is UPGMA, which builds a tree by a sequential clustering method
  2.    Given a distance matrix, it starts by grouping two taxa with the largest pairwise distance in the distance matrix
  3.    The distances between this new composite taxon and all remaining taxa are calculated to create a reduced matrix
  4.    The grouping process is repeated and another newly reduced matrix is created
 Discuss Question
Answer: Option B. -> Given a distance matrix, it starts by grouping two taxa with the largest pairwise distance in the distance matrix

Question 58. To use molecular data to reconstruct evolutionary history requires making a number of reasonable assumptions. Which of the following is incorrect about it?
  1.    The molecular sequences used in phylogenetic construction are homologous
  2.    The molecular sequences used in phylogenetic construction share a common origin
  3.    Phylogenetic divergence cannot be bifurcating
  4.    Parent branch splits into two daughter branches at any given point
 Discuss Question
Answer: Option C. -> Phylogenetic divergence cannot be bifurcating
